Class OntologyTermHitMetaData

  • All Implemented Interfaces:
    org.molgenis.data.Entity, org.molgenis.util.i18n.Identifiable, org.molgenis.util.i18n.Labeled

    @Component
    public class OntologyTermHitMetaData
    extends org.molgenis.data.meta.SystemEntityType
    • Nested Class Summary

      • Nested classes/interfaces inherited from class org.molgenis.data.meta.model.EntityType

        org.molgenis.data.meta.model.EntityType.AttributeCopyMode, org.molgenis.data.meta.model.EntityType.AttributeRole
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static java.lang.String COMBINED_SCORE  
      static java.lang.String ID  
      static java.lang.String ONTOLOGY_TERM_HIT  
      static java.lang.String SCORE  
    • Constructor Summary

      Constructors 
      Constructor Description
      OntologyTermHitMetaData​(org.molgenis.ontology.core.model.OntologyPackage ontologyPackage, org.molgenis.ontology.core.meta.OntologyTermSynonymMetadata ontologyTermSynonymMetadata, org.molgenis.ontology.core.meta.OntologyTermDynamicAnnotationMetadata ontologyTermDynamicAnnotationMetadata, org.molgenis.ontology.core.meta.OntologyTermNodePathMetadata ontologyTermNodePathMetadata, org.molgenis.ontology.core.meta.OntologyMetadata ontologyMetadata)  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void init()  
      • Methods inherited from class org.molgenis.data.meta.SystemEntityType

        addAttribute, bootstrap, get, getDependencies, getId, getIdValue, getString, isRowLevelSecured, setAttributeFactory, setIdGenerator, setRowLevelSecured
      • Methods inherited from class org.molgenis.data.meta.model.EntityType

        addAttribute, addAttributes, addTag, deepCopyAttributes, getAllAttributes, getAtomicAttributes, getAttribute, getAttributeNames, getAttributes, getBackend, getDescription, getDescription, getExtends, getIdAttribute, getIndexingDepth, getInversedByAttributes, getLabel, getLabel, getLabelAttribute, getLabelAttribute, getLookupAttribute, getLookupAttributes, getMappedByAttributes, getOwnAllAttributes, getOwnAtomicAttributes, getOwnAttributes, getOwnIdAttribute, getOwnLabelAttribute, getOwnLabelAttribute, getOwnLookupAttributes, getOwnMappedByAttributes, getPackage, getTags, hasAttributeWithExpression, hasBidirectionalAttributes, hasInversedByAttributes, hasMappedByAttributes, isAbstract, newInstance, newInstance, removeAttribute, removeTag, set, setAbstract, setAttributeRoles, setBackend, setDefaultValues, setDescription, setDescription, setExtends, setId, setIndexingDepth, setLabel, setLabel, setOwnAllAttributes, setPackage, setTags, toString
      • Methods inherited from class org.molgenis.data.support.StaticEntity

        getBoolean, getDouble, getEntities, getEntities, getEntity, getEntity, getEntityType, getInstant, getInt, getLabelValue, getLocalDate, getLong, init, set, setIdValue
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
      • Methods inherited from interface org.molgenis.data.Entity

        get, getBoolean, getDouble, getEntities, getEntities, getEntity, getEntity, getInstant, getInt, getLocalDate, getLong, getString, set
    • Constructor Detail

      • OntologyTermHitMetaData

        public OntologyTermHitMetaData​(org.molgenis.ontology.core.model.OntologyPackage ontologyPackage,
                                       org.molgenis.ontology.core.meta.OntologyTermSynonymMetadata ontologyTermSynonymMetadata,
                                       org.molgenis.ontology.core.meta.OntologyTermDynamicAnnotationMetadata ontologyTermDynamicAnnotationMetadata,
                                       org.molgenis.ontology.core.meta.OntologyTermNodePathMetadata ontologyTermNodePathMetadata,
                                       org.molgenis.ontology.core.meta.OntologyMetadata ontologyMetadata)
    • Method Detail

      • init

        public void init()
        Specified by:
        init in class org.molgenis.data.meta.SystemEntityType